H.R. 3408 (104th)

To amend title 10, United States Code, to revise the provisions of law relating to payment of retired pay of retired members of the Armed Forces to former spouses, and for other purposes.

Summary

Requires that the disposable retired pay of a member or former member of the armed forces to whom a final decree of divorce, dissolution, annulment, or legal separation is issued before the date that such member begins to receive retired pay, for purposes of determining the amount of such payments to the former spouse, shall be computed based on the pay grade and length of service of the member while married to the former spouse. Requires the former spouse to make application for his or her share of such retired pay within one year from the date of the final decree. Amends the Uniformed Services Former Spouses' Protection Act to require the Secretary of Defense to prescribe regulations to provide that a former spouse of a member of the armed forces loses commissary and exchange privileges when a decree of divorce, dissolution, or annulment becomes final.
